Memory anchors
Integral sine is negative cosine
∫sin(ax)dx = −cos(ax)/a + C.
Integral cosine is positive sine
∫cos(ax)dx = sin(ax)/a + C.
Inside coefficient divides
Reverse differentiation by dividing by the angle multiplier.
Shift stays inside
Preserve qx + r while adjusting for q.
dy/dx invites integration
Integrate f(x) to recover the family of y-functions.
Condition fixes C
Substitute the known point after integrating.
